Staffordand its attractions for luxury travelers

Stafford, a charming market town in the heart of England, offers luxury travellers a delightful mix of history and elegance. Begin your exploration at the stunning Shugborough Hall, a magnificent Georgian mansion set amidst beautiful gardens and parkland, where you can enjoy guided tours and seasonal events that showcase the estate's rich heritage. For art enthusiasts, the Ancient High House, one of the largest timber-framed houses in England, hosts exhibitions and provides a glimpse into the region's past. A visit to Stafford Castle promises breathtaking views and a fascinating insight into medieval life, perfect for those looking to immerse themselves in local history. For nature lovers, the tranquil expanses of Cannock Chase Forest offer opportunities for scenic walks and outdoor activities, with its lush landscapes providing a serene escape. When can I expect good weather in Stafford?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Stafford rel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Stafford is 807 mm.
